As a property manager, maintaining the integrity of plumbing systems is crucial to ensuring tenant satisfaction and preserving the value of your properties. One effective strategy is implementing seasonal plumbing evaluations for property management. These evaluations help identify potential issues before they escalate into costly repairs, saving time and resources.
Seasonal plumbing evaluations allow property managers to stay proactive about maintenance. They provide several key benefits, including:
Regular assessments can pinpoint areas needing immediate attention and facilitate timely repairs.
Addressing plumbing issues early can significantly reduce the costs associated with emergency repairs and downtime.
A well-maintained plumbing system enhances your property’s overall appeal and market value, attracting high-quality tenants.
Ensuring plumbing systems are up to code can prevent hazardous situations like leaks or burst pipes that pose risks to both property and residents.
When conducting seasonal plumbing evaluations, certain critical components should be inspected to ensure everything is functioning optimally.
Inspect all visible pipes and fittings for leaks, corrosion, or damage. Pay special attention to connections, as these are common areas where leaks develop.
Ensure that water heaters are functioning efficiently. Check for any signs of sediment buildup and assess the temperature settings to prevent scalding or energy wastage.
Conduct thorough inspections of all drains to identify blockages or buildup. Regular drain cleaning can prevent backups that disrupt service and lead to costly repairs.
Evaluate all plumbing fixtures — including faucets, toilets, and showerheads — for leaks and functionality. Replacing worn-out washers or seals can dramatically enhance efficiency.
Different seasons present unique challenges for plumbing. In winter, for example, pipes are at risk of freezing. During fall, leaves may clog gutters and drains, requiring preemptive cleaning.

Conducting an effective seasonal plumbing evaluation involves a systematic process:
Step 1: Gather Necessary Tools
Ensure that you have the right tools on hand, such as wrenches, a pressure gauge, and inspection mirrors.
Step 2: Create a Checklist
Develop a comprehensive checklist that includes all systems and components requiring evaluation. This ensures thoroughness in the assessment.
Step 3: Perform Inspections
Check each item on your checklist while documenting any issues or areas for improvement.
Step 4: Address Immediate Concerns
If you identify urgent repairs or maintenance needs, address them promptly to minimize disruption.
Step 5: Plan for Future Maintenance
Use your findings to schedule further preventative maintenance and prioritize repairs throughout the year.
What is the importance of seasonal plumbing evaluations for property management?
Seasonal plumbing evaluations help identify potential plumbing issues early, reducing emergency repair costs and enhancing tenant safety and satisfaction.
How often should plumbing evaluations be conducted?
It is recommended to conduct evaluations at least once per season to address seasonal challenges and ensure optimal performance.
Can I conduct these evaluations myself?
While some minor checks can be done by a property manager, it is advisable to hire a professional plumbing service for comprehensive evaluations and repairs.
What should I do if I discover a plumbing issue during an evaluation?
Address any discovered issues immediately by contacting a licensed plumbing professional. Prompt attention can often prevent further damage and cost escalation.
